Our hidden mold remediation process in Bridgehampton, NY

Inspect

We use moisture meters, thermal imaging, and borescope cameras to locate mold without demolishing the whole wall.

Contain

Once located, we seal off the access area before opening it up to prevent spore spread.

Remove

We open only what's necessary to reach the mold and remove affected material.

Dry

We dry the cavity and surrounding materials to stop the conditions that let mold grow there.

Verify

We confirm the cavity is clean and dry before any repair or closeup work happens.

Hidden Mold Remediation cost in Bridgehampton, NY

Every job is different, so here are the typical New York ranges we see. These are planning numbers, not a quote.

Small area
$500 to $1,500

A single moldy spot, a closet, or under a sink. We contain it, remove it, and treat the surface.

One room
$1,500 to $3,500

A bathroom, kitchen, or bedroom with mold on a wall or ceiling, plus the moisture source fixed.

Basement, attic, or crawl space
$2,000 to $6,000

Larger areas that need more containment and drying. Common here after spring rain or a slow leak.

Whole-house or severe
$10,000 and up

Mold across several rooms or after major water damage. We work in phases, room by room.

Hidden Mold Remediation in Bridgehampton, NY: common questions

I smell mold but can't see any. What should I do?

A persistent musty smell with no visible source is worth having inspected. We use moisture meters and cameras to locate hidden mold without unnecessary demolition.

Can hidden mold make a home smell musty without being visible?

Yes, mold growing inside a wall cavity, under flooring, or behind a cabinet can produce a noticeable smell well before it becomes visible on a surface.

Is hidden mold more dangerous than visible mold?

It isn't inherently more dangerous, but it often goes untreated longer since nobody knows it's there, which can let it spread further before it's addressed.

Do I need to leave my Bridgehampton home during the work?

Usually no. We seal the work area under negative air, so most of the Bridgehampton home stays livable. For larger jobs we will tell you if it is better to step out for a day.

Will you have to cut open my walls?

Sometimes a small opening is needed to confirm and access hidden mold, but we always try to locate it first with non-invasive tools to keep the opening as small as possible.

How do I know if past water damage left mold behind?

If an area was wet in the past and the smell or discoloration returned later, it's a strong indicator that moisture remained trapped inside a cavity.
